The Fuji Five Lakes region is one of the best places to ride in Japan - flat lakeshore loops for beginners and one of the great hill climbs in the world for anyone with strong legs.

Kawaguchiko Station and the surrounding lakefront have several rental shops offering city bikes (~¥1,500 a day), e-bikes (~¥3,500) and road bikes (~¥5,000). Bring your own helmet if you can - rental options are limited. Book ahead on weekends from April to November.
